Biscuits getting new trainer

The Rays have promoted Durham trainer Mark Vinson (pictured at right, from his younger days) to be their minor-league rehabilitation and athletic training coordinator, which means Biscuits trainer Jimmy Southard is moving up to the Bulls. The Biscuits will have Joel Smith as their trainer this year.

Smith will be in his fifth season in the Tampa Bay organization. He was at high-Class A Vero Beach last year, his first stop at a full-season affiliate. Vinson was with the Biscuits in 2006 before Southard took over in 2007.

The Rays also named minor-league hitting coordinator Steve Livesey their player development man of the year and Fred Repke their top scout. Repke is in charge of scouting Southern California and signed Rays pitcher Jamie Shields and third baseman Evan Longoria.
